In the Edexcel IGCSE Physics exam, questions worth 4 to 6 marks often demand extended written answers, sometimes referred to as “essay” questions. These assess your ability to explain scientific concepts with clarity, apply physical principles to unfamiliar contexts, and construct logical chains of reasoning. Mastering this extended-response skill is vital for achieving top grades and demonstrates a deep understanding beyond simple recall.

1. Why Extended Writing Matters in Physics | 为什么物理中的扩展写作很重要
The extended-response question is not just a test of knowledge; it examines how well you can communicate scientific thinking. A concise, well-structured answer separates a grade 8/9 candidate from a grade 5/6 performer. The examiners look for precise use of terminology, explicit cause-and-effect relationships, and the ability to link different parts of the specification under one theme. Treat each 6-mark question as a mini essay where you are the teacher explaining a phenomenon to a student.

2. Decoding the Question | 解码问题
Before writing a single word, underline the command verb: “explain”, “describe”, “compare” or “evaluate”. An “explain” question requires reasons and mechanisms (cause then effect), while “describe” needs a sequence of observations without deep justification. Also highlight the key physics vocabulary – words like “terminal velocity”, “resultant force”, “electromagnetic induction”. Check the mark allocation; a 6-mark question usually expects three distinct but connected points, each with developed reasoning.

3. The PEEL Framework for Physics Essays | 物理小论文的PEEL框架
A robust structure is the PEEL model: Point, Evidence, Explain, Link. Begin a paragraph with a clear statement that directly tackles the question. Support it with a scientific law, equation or observation. Then elaborate the reasoning step by step, showing the physics behind the claim. Finally, tie the idea back to the question or create a bridge to the next paragraph. This framework ensures your answer stays focused and gains full marks for logical development.

| Point – State the idea that directly addresses the question. | 论点 – 陈述直接回应问题的观点。 |
| Evidence – Use a physics law, equation or observation. | 证据 – 引用物理定律、方程或观察结果。 |
| Explain – Describe the chain of reasoning with cause and effect. | 解释 – 运用因果关系描述推理链条。 |
| Link – Connect back to the question or to the next paragraph. | 联系 – 回扣问题或连接下一段。 |
4. Planning Your Answer | 规划你的答案
Spend 2–3 minutes sketching a quick flowchart or bullet-point plan. List the key physics principles in the order they occur. For a question on terminal velocity, a useful plan might read: (1) Weight acting downward, negligible drag initially; (2) Resultant force causing downward acceleration (Newton’s second law); (3) Drag increases with speed, reducing net force; (4) Forces balance, zero acceleration, constant terminal velocity. This blueprint prevents rambling and ensures you cover all marking points.

5. Crafting a Strong Introduction | 撰写有力的引言
Your introduction should rephrase the question and immediately name the overarching physics concept. Avoid lengthy storytelling. For example: “As a skydiver falls, two main forces act: weight downwards and air resistance upwards. The motion is determined by the resultant of these forces at each instant.” This shows the examiner you understand the core mechanism from the very first sentence. Keep it to two or three sentences; save the detail for body paragraphs.
